Georgics by Virgil. 29 BC. Miniature depicting two musicians

Publius Vergilius Maro (70 BC-19 BC). Roman poet. Georgics. 29 BC. Manuscript. 15th century. Fol.51. Miniature depicting two musicians playing instruments. Library University of Valencia. Spain

EDITORS COMMENTS
This exquisite 15th century miniature, housed in the Library of the University of Valencia in Spain, offers a captivating glimpse into the ancient world of Roman poetry as depicted in the Georgics by Publius Vergilius Maro, better known as Virgil. Dating back to 29 BC, the Georgics is an epic poem that celebrates the rural life, agriculture, and the virtues of country living. This miniature, found on Folio 51 of the manuscript, illustrates two musicians engrossed in their art, playing their instruments in the idyllic setting of an open-air scene. The musicians, dressed in simple robes, are seated on either side of a tree-lined path, surrounded by the verdant scenery of a forest. The elder musician strums a lyre, his eyes closed in concentration, while the younger one beats a drum with an animated rhythm. The serene atmosphere is further enhanced by the tranquil road winding through the landscape, leading to a distant house, symbolizing the simple pleasures of rural life. The Georgics, written during the Augustan period, is considered one of the greatest works of Latin literature, reflecting the cultural and artistic achievements of ancient Rome. This miniature, with its intricate details and vibrant colors, offers a visual representation of the text's themes of music, nature, and the simple pleasures of country living, making it an invaluable addition to the University of Valencia's collection.
